  175   Thursday, November 23, 2017, 13:39 Marla CervantesUO2/C40282-2 TARGET BOATDoneCarbonizing UO2/C discs for 1stepUCx in graphite sample container _#3

 Thursday, November 23, 2017, 13:34

Circles from cast 1 were used, the same as the last round of 1stepUCx [see elog i.d. 164]

A 14mm punch was used to punch out circles from the cast.

35 circles were packed into a graphite sample container.

35 x UO2/C circles = 5.75 g

Graphite container = 5.38 g

Graphite container is placed inside a target boat.

Boat previously coated with TaC and sintered.

Ta-target boat is wrapped with 3-layers of heat shield and installed in Evap1.

Chamber currently pumping down.


 Friday, November 24, 2017, 12:48

IGP1=1.3e-6 Torr

TGHT = 520A, 4.98V 

Vacuum went down indicating carbonization.

Will remain at max setpoint for the weekend.


 Monday, November 27, 2017, 09:58

IG1 = 2.6e-6 Torr

TGHT = 520A, 5.1V

Carbonization complete in 3 hrs and 30 min.

Initiating auto-cool at 2.0A/min


 Wednesday, November 27, 2017, 13:10

 IEVAP was vented in argon and sample removed/transferred to glove box on Friday.

  178   Wednesday, January 17, 2018, 13:47 Marla CervantesUO2/C40282-1TARGET BOATDoneCarbonizing UO2/C discs for 1stepUCx in graphite sample container _#5

 Monday, January 15, 2018, 13:37

35 circles of 14 mm diameter were packed into a graphite sample container.

35 x UO2/C circles = 5.58 g

Graphite container = 5.22 g

Graphite tube is placed inside a target boat.

Boat previously coated with TaC and sintered.

Ta-target boat is wrapped with 3 new Ta foils for heat shielding and the boat was installed in Evap1.

Chamber currently pumping down.


Tuesday, January 16, 2018, 13:41 

Initial IGP1 = 9x10e-7 Torr

Tapped up entire process manually to 520A in 1.5 hrs

TGHT = 525 A, 5.64 V

Vacuum coming down nicely indicating carbonization process complete 

Will remain at max setpoint overnight to ensure full carbonization before cooling down.


Wednesday, January 17, 2018, 10:30

Initiating auto-cool at 2.0A/min 


Wednesday, January 17, 2018, 4:30

Vented with Argon and removed form evaporator 1
